A new wheat variety, Bhakkar Star, has been developed through selection from CIMMYT germplasm. It combines high yield potential, tolerance to temperature stress and resistance to major diseases. From 2011 to 2018, the variety underwent preliminary and advanced yield trials at the Arid Zone Research Institute, Bhakkar, in collaboration with provincial and national wheat research organizations. Morphologically, Bhakkar Star has a semi-erect flag leaf, white auricles, and a tapering head measuring 12-14 cm with 22-24 spikelets per spike. It demonstrates strong tillering capacity, producing about 140-145 tillers per meter row. The grains are ovate, medium-sized, amber-colored and weight 42-46 g per 1,000 kernels, with a protein content of 16%. The variety performs exceptionally well under poor sandy soils, early season sowing and terminal heat stress conditions. It also maintains productivity under late and very late planting environments, making it a versatile choice for farmers in hot irrigated and dry climates of Pakistan. Its high protein content, along with desirable gluten quality, contributes to excellent chapatti-making and bread quality. Bhakkar Star is resistant to prevailing strains of leaf and yellow rusts and shows a tolerant response to local stem rust strains. Recognizing its agronomic and quality traits, the Punjab Seed Council (PSC) has approved Bhakkar Star as a commercial wheat variety aimed at enhancing wheat yield potential for farmers in stress-prone environments.
